Indices of multiple deprivation (IMD) are commonly used datasets in the UK to assess the relative level of deprivation, which is essentially a measure of poverty, in small geographic areas. These indices combine various indicators of deprivation, each assigned a different weight, to generate an overall deprivation score. The IMD scores provide valuable insights into the socio-economic conditions of different areas.
